Understanding the Core Gameplay Loop

At its heart, the chicken road game revolves around a straightforward mechanic. Players begin with a small initial bet and watch as their chicken character progresses along a winding road. As the chicken moves forward, the win multiplier increases, drastically escalating the potential payout. However, hidden amongst the seemingly endless path are various obstacles, like foxes or potholes, that instantly end the game and forfeit any accumulated winnings. This inherent risk is what adds a significant layer of excitement and tension, requiring players to carefully balance risk and reward.

The addictive nature of this game stems from its simplicity and the psychological principle of near misses. Even when a player encounters an obstacle, the feeling of “almost” winning can be powerful enough to encourage another attempt. The escalating multiplier also plays a key role, as the potential payout grows increasingly tempting with each step taken. This creates a compelling loop of anticipation and excitement.

Making the strategic decision of when to cash out is, arguably, the most crucial element of the game. Holding on for a larger multiplier offers the possibility of substantial gains, but also greatly increases the likelihood of hitting an obstacle and losing everything. The balance between greed and caution is a critical skill to master when navigating the chicken’s journey.

The Psychological Appeal: Why It’s So Engaging

Beyond the simple mechanics, the chicken road game taps into some fundamental psychological principles that make it so captivating. The variable reward system, where payouts aren’t guaranteed with every spin, releases dopamine in the brain, creating a pleasurable and addictive experience. This is the same mechanism that drives many other forms of entertainment, from slot machines to social media. The anticipation of a win is often more rewarding than the win itself, and this game excels at cultivating that feeling.

The game also provides a sense of control, albeit an illusionary one. Players feel as though their timing of the cash-out is a skillful decision, adding their own input to the outcome of the game. This creates a sense of agency, making players feel more invested in the game and more likely to continue playing. This sensation is amplified by the immediate feedback mechanism – seeing the multiplier increase with each step taken.

Furthermore, the lighthearted and whimsical theme, with its charming chicken character, helps to create a relaxed and enjoyable atmosphere. Unlike more serious casino games, the chicken road game doesn’t carry the same weight of financial risk or social pressure, making it a more accessible and carefree form of entertainment.

Bankroll Management and Responsible Gaming

Effective bankroll management is paramount in any form of gaming, and the chicken road game is no exception. Determining a specific amount of money you’re willing to spend before you begin, and sticking to that limit, is the foundation of responsible gaming. It’s vital to avoid chasing losses, attempting to recoup funds that have already been lost by increasing your bets or playing for extended periods. Implementing a win limit – a predetermined amount you’ll stop playing at once you’ve reached it – can also help to secure profits and prevent overspending.

Recognizing the signs of potential problem gambling is crucial. If you find yourself spending more time and money on the game than intended, neglecting personal responsibilities, or experiencing feelings of guilt or shame, it’s important to seek help. Numerous resources are available to provide support and guidance for individuals struggling with gambling addiction. Remember, the game should remain a fun and harmless pastime, not a source of stress or financial hardship.

Setting time limits for your gaming sessions can significantly reduce the risk of compulsive play. Utilise built-in timers or external reminders to ensure that breaks are taken, and that gaming does not interfere with other important aspects of life. Maintaining a healthy balance between gaming and life responsibilities is key to enjoying the experience responsibly and sustainably.
